Perhaps something that is obvious, but not to me. Google leads me down a series of sophisticated and complex rabbit holes, I think misunderstanding what I require.
I have a grid, essentially made up from blanks or jpgs, with some text, which makes a diagram for supervising a home automation system. It needs to be on a single screen, so that the status can be seen at a glance. The grid is 11x10, so not far off square. I don't really care if some of the finer detail, such as some of the text can't be read correctly on a phone screen, but I do not want to be scrolling.
Works well on my desktop monitor and on my phone screen in portrait. However in landscape the width fills the screen and the height needs to be scrolled. Seems like it is irritatingly doing as I told it to do with....

<meta name="viewport" content="width=device-width, initial-scale=1">

So what I want is that on the phone in landscape mode the limiting factor is height, scale to that.

Obviously stuff like @media rearranging the blocks in the grid is absolutely not what I want. I wouldn't even mind if on a very small screen it were stretched to fill the available space.

Any ideas what I should be looking up and studying to find a solution?
